How they compare

Netherlands currently reports 2,338 against 1,981 in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, a difference of 357.

That makes Netherlands's figure about 1.2 times United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land's.

Across all 26 years both countries report, Netherlands has been ahead every year.

Netherlands ranks 101st and United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 104th of 173 countries.

Netherlands has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Netherlands United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land Difference Ahead
1990s 1,078 592 486 Netherlands
2000s 1,268 768.5 499.1 Netherlands
2010s 1,512 1,117 394.9 Netherlands
2020s 1,853 1,656 196.82 Netherlands

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Data refer to the minimum monthly earnings of all employees as of December 31st of each year. Minimum wages are not reported for countries for which collective bargaining is in place for minimum wages. In cases where a national minimum wage is not mandated, the minimum wage in place in the capital or major city is used. In some cases, an average of multiple regional minimum wages is used. In countries where the minimum wage is set at the sectoral level or occupational level, the minimum wage for manufacturing or unskilled workers is generally applied. Data are converted to U.S. dollars as the common currency, using exchange rates or purchasing power parity (PPP) rates rates for private consumption expenditures. The latter series allows for international comparisons by taking account of the differences in relative prices between countries. For more information, refer to the Wages and Working Time Statistics (COND) database description.
